Slide 3 Atherothrombosis: a Generalized and Progressive Process Atherothrombosis is the common underlying disease process for MI, ischemia and vascular death. ACS are classic examples of atherothrombosis (plaque rupture and thrombus formation). ACS (in common with ischemic stroke and critical leg ischemia) are typically caused by rupture or erosion of an atherosclerotic plaque followed by formation of a platelet-rich thrombus. Atherosclerosis is an ongoing process affecting mainly large and medium-sized arteries, which can begin in childhood and progress throughout a person’s lifetime. Stable atherosclerotic plaques may encroach on the lumen of the artery and cause chronic ischemia, resulting in (stable) angina pectoris or intermittent claudication, depending on the vascular bed affected. Unstable atherosclerotic plaques may rupture, leading to the formation of a platelet-rich thrombus that partially or completely occludes the artery and causes acute ischemic symptoms. References: 1. Acute coronary syndrome (ACS), notably unstable angina or non-Q-wave myocardial infarction (MI), are classic manifestations of atherothrombosis.
